3-D Geometry

Term
Definition
Volume   The number of cubic units needed to fill a solid figure  
🗑
Vertex   The point of intersection of two sides of a polygon.  
🗑
Prism   A polyhedron with two congruent and parallel polygon-shaped faces.  
🗑
Net   A plane figure pattern which, when folded, makes a solid.  
🗑
Cylinder   A three-dimensional figure that has two circular bases, which are parallel and congruent.  
🗑
Sphere   A three-dimensional figure such that every point is the same distance form the center.  
🗑
Cone   A three-dimensional figure that has one circular base. The points on this circle are joined to one point outside the base.  
🗑
Edge   The line segment where two faces of a polyhedron meet.  
🗑
Face   A flat surface of a polyhedron.  
🗑
Cubic Unit   A unit measuring volume, consisting of a cube with edges one unit long.
